## What it is
Zadig is an open-source, cloud-native DevOps platform built on Kubernetes and AI large language models. It provides CI/CD workflows, release strategy orchestration, environment management, AI code review, and enterprise dashboards for managing thousands of microservices.

## When to choose
- your teams deploy to kubernetes and need a self-service internal developer platform
- you want batch management of many microservices with templated projects
- you need ai-assisted code review and release risk analysis built into delivery pipelines

## When to avoid
- you only need a lightweight single CI pipeline without environment management
- your infrastructure is not containerized or kubernetes-based
- you require a permissive OSI license - the license is a custom non-standard one
